The Colorado Neurological Institute's mission is to enhance the delivery of personalized, comprehensive and state-of-the-art care to patients with neurological conditions through coordinated patient care, education, research, and outreach activities.
Colorado Neurological Institute was founded in 1988 and is a non-profit organization dedicated to serving those touched by a neurological condition.
CNI arose from a significant community need that we continue to address to this day:
Patients with neurological conditions often find that they do not have access to the comprehensive care, support, and resources they need.
In partnership with our distinguished member physicians, we provide comprehensive care for a full spectrum of neurological disorders, including epilepsy, movement disorders, brain and spinal tumors, head trauma, hearing disorders, stroke, sleep disorders, migraines, neuromuscular disorders, and more.
CNI is today the largest and most comprehensive neuroscience center in the Rocky Mountain region. We are recognized by Neurosource as a Neuroscience Center of Excellence.
Unlike traditional hospitals and medical centers, CNI provides a unique collaborative environment that allows top neurological specialists and medical professionals from multiple fields and disciplines to blend their knowledge, skills and experience to provide the highest level of care and support to patients and their families. This unique approach allows CNI to offer a complete continuum of care that addresses every aspect of a patient’s diagnostic, treatment and rehabilitation needs in the most cost-effective manner possible. CNI also partners with other leading medical organizations to enhance the breadth and depth of capabilities available to patients and their families. These include Swedish Medical Center, a Level I Trauma Center and acute care hospital, Craig Hospital and Spalding Rehabilitation Hospital.
